Judith Lampasso is a scholar working on Molecular Biology, Orthodontics and Physiology. According to data from OpenAlex, Judith Lampasso has authored 11 papers receiving a total of 318 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 4 papers in Orthodontics and 4 papers in Physiology. Recurrent topics in Judith Lampasso's work include Orthodontics and Dentofacial Orthopedics (4 papers), Protein Kinase Regulation and GTPase Signaling (3 papers) and Temporomandibular Joint Disorders (3 papers). Judith Lampasso is often cited by papers focused on Orthodontics and Dentofacial Orthopedics (4 papers), Protein Kinase Regulation and GTPase Signaling (3 papers) and Temporomandibular Joint Disorders (3 papers). Judith Lampasso collaborates with scholars based in United States. Judith Lampasso's co-authors include Charles Brian Preston, Robert G. Dunford, Rosemary Dziak, Joseph E. Margarone, Phillip V. Tobias, Wen Chen, W.D. McCall, T. John Martin, Angela R. Kamer and Hiran Perinpanayagam and has published in prestigious journals such as Journal of Bone and Mineral Research, American Journal of Orthodontics and Dentofacial Orthopedics and Journal of Oral and Maxillofacial Surgery.

All Works

11 of 11 papers shown
1.
Preston, Charles Brian, et al.. (2008). Long-term effectiveness of the continuous and the sectional archwire techniques in leveling the curve of Spee. American Journal of Orthodontics and Dentofacial Orthopedics. 133(4). 550–555. 21 indexed citations
2.
Lampasso, Judith, et al.. (2007). Malocclusion as a risk factor in the etiology of headaches in children and adolescents. American Journal of Orthodontics and Dentofacial Orthopedics. 132(6). 754–761. 26 indexed citations
3.
Preston, Charles Brian, et al.. (2007). Leveling the curve of Spee with a continuous archwire technique: A long term cephalometric study. American Journal of Orthodontics and Dentofacial Orthopedics. 131(3). 363–371. 51 indexed citations
4.
Lampasso, Judith, et al.. (2006). The expression profile of PKC isoforms during MC3T3-E1 differentiation. International Journal of Molecular Medicine. 17(6). 1125–31. 20 indexed citations
5.
Perinpanayagam, Hiran, et al.. (2005). Alveolar bone osteoblast differentiation and Runx2/Cbfa1 expression. Archives of Oral Biology. 51(5). 406–415. 26 indexed citations
6.
Preston, Charles Brian, et al.. (2005). Prediction Accuracy of Computer-Assisted Surgical Visual Treatment Objectives as Compared With Conventional Visual Treatment Objectives. Journal of Oral and Maxillofacial Surgery. 63(5). 609–617. 43 indexed citations
7.
Preston, Charles Brian, et al.. (2005). The effects of computer-aided anteroposterior maxillary incisor movement on ratings of facial attractiveness. American Journal of Orthodontics and Dentofacial Orthopedics. 127(1). 17–24. 65 indexed citations
8.
Lampasso, Judith, et al.. (2004). Allergy, nasal obstruction, and occlusion. Seminars in Orthodontics. 10(1). 39–44. 9 indexed citations
9.
Preston, Charles Brian, Judith Lampasso, & Phillip V. Tobias. (2004). Cephalometric evaluation and measurement of the upper airway. Seminars in Orthodontics. 10(1). 3–15. 20 indexed citations
10.
Lampasso, Judith, et al.. (2002). Role of Protein Kinase C α in Primary Human Osteoblast Proliferation. Journal of Bone and Mineral Research. 17(11). 1968–1976. 23 indexed citations
11.
Lampasso, Judith, Angela R. Kamer, Joseph E. Margarone, & Rosemary Dziak. (2001). Sphingosine-1-phosphate effects on PKC isoform expression in human osteoblastic cells. Prostaglandins Leukotrienes and Essential Fatty Acids. 65(3). 139–146. 14 indexed citations
